Foldable Wireless Chargers with Qi2
BoostCharge Magnetic Foldable Charger
This folding stand design is compact and travel ready. Delivering 15W of fast wireless charging to iPhone and other Qi2 enabled devices, its powerful magnetic connection secures the device to charging stand and magnetically holds it vertically or horizontally for hands-free use. Use the elevated, customizable position to scroll or watch, and support the Standby Mode feature for iPhone users. It is available in two versions: standalone charges phone only; the 2-in-1 version charges phone and earbuds. 20W power supply and USB-C cable are included. Premium materials include soft touch phone pad, non-slip base and durable hinge construction.

BoostCharge 3-in-1 Magnetic Foldable Charger
Charge all your essentials with this foldable 3-in-1. Both portable and with customizable charging angles, it delivers 15W of fast wireless charging to iPhone or Qi2 enabled device, 5W to Apple Watch and 5W for earbuds. If used as a pad, keep it flat. If a stand is preferred, the pad lifts easily and holds steady. Simply fold it down for safe transport when it’s time to pack it away.

BoostCharge Pro Magnetic Wireless Travel Pad
A traveller’s best friend. Available in both 2-in-1 and 3-in-1 versions, use it as a pad or fold up into a stand. It delivers 15W of fast wireless charging to iPhone or Qi2 enabled device, 5W to Apple Watch and 5W for earbuds. Qi2 magnetic technology means the phone is held secure, optimizing energy usage and safeguarding the device's battery life.

High-capacityPower Banks
BoostCharge Power Bank 10K w/ Integrated Cable
This compact 10K power bank makes charging easy. With integrated PD PPS, charge a USB-C smartphone, earbuds or tablet. It provides the option to split the power and charge multiple devices at once. Available in Black, Blue and Pink and White (MEA exclusive).

BoostCharge Pro 3-Port Laptop Power Bank 20K
This 65W power bank is built with a 20K battery capacity; enough to charge a laptop, MacBook or smartphone quickly and safely. Its full colour digital display shows battery status to easily monitor the remaining charge and manage power needs efficiently for all devices. Options for 65W PD via single USB-C connection or split the power across two USB-Cs and a USB-A, to charge 3 devices simultaneously.

Cables Made More Responsibly
BoostCharge 2-in-1 USB-C and Lightning Cable
Charge existing and future devices with this 2-in-1 cable. MFi and USB-IF certified and tested to over 30,000 bends and over 10,000 plug-ins, this cable will deliver up to 60W of power to any USB-C or Lightning device. It features a built-in interchangeable Lightning connector for users to easily switch between their charging needs. A handy cable strap keeps things tidy and protects it from tangles. Exterior braiding is made of 100% post-consumer recycled polyester, certified by the Global Recycled Standard (GRS), cable head and internal jacket are made of 50% GRS-certified post-consumer recycled thermoplastic.
This is part of a rolling change to transition all our PVC and Braided PVC to PCR material.

Portable Keyboards for Work-on-the-go
Pro Keyboard Case collection
The Belkin Pro Keyboard case makes working from anywhere, easy. The backlit Bluetooth keyboard pairs to iPad to offer the ease of use of an external keyboard with the added defence of a protective cover. The premium faux leather exterior protects the device, while a soft, anti-slip interior protects the screen from scratches. It auto wakes/sleeps when opening/closing, and features a large, click-anywhere trackpad. Its long-lasting battery (between 460mAh – 600mAh) holds charge independently from iPad.
